在数字化时代,程序下载已成为用户获取软件的核心需求。本文将从多系统平台兼容性、工具选择策略、下载效率优化、安全防护机制四大维度展开,结合主流操作系统(Windows/Linux/Android)和跨平台场景,解析如何通过官方渠道、第三方工具及进阶技巧实现高效且安全的程序下载。文中将重点推荐微软商店、包管理器、IDM等工具,并揭示多线程加速、云测验证等专业技巧,帮助用户规避恶意软件风险,全面提升下载体验。
一、官方渠道:安全下载的基石
1. 操作系统内置应用商店
Windows 11用户可通过Microsoft Store获取官方认证的应用程序,搜索目标软件后点击“获取”即可完成下载安装,其优势在于自动处理依赖库与数字签名验证。Linux系统则依赖发行版专属包管理器,如Ubuntu的apt、Fedora的dnf等,通过命令行输入sudo apt install package_name
可精准安装所需软件。
2. 开发者官网直链下载
对于专业级软件(如Adobe全家桶、JetBrains开发工具),建议直接访问官网下载页。以Microsoft Office为例,需通过订阅账户登录后获取安装包,避免第三方渠道篡改风险。此类下载需注意核对域名真实性,警惕钓鱼网站。
二、第三方工具:效率提升的关键
1. 多线程下载工具推荐
• IDM(Internet Download Manager):支持HTTP/FTP协议,通过8线程加速实现500%速度提升,内置站点抓取功能可批量下载网页资源。
• Free Download Manager:开源免费,兼容BT种子与磁力链接,支持流量调度与断点续传,适合大文件分段下载。2. 跨平台下载解决方案
• Snap/Flatpak:Linux环境下无需处理依赖关系的通用包格式,例如snap install spotify
可一键安装最新版音乐客户端。
三、安全防护:规避风险的核心策略
1. 来源验证与权限管理
• 安卓APK文件需通过apksigner verify
验证签名,避免注入恶意代码。第三方平台下载时应选择CNET、FileHippo等信誉站点。
2. 病毒扫描与沙盒测试
使用火绒安全软件或VirusTotal在线扫描工具对下载包进行多引擎检测。可疑文件可在Sandboxie沙盒环境中运行,隔离潜在威胁。
四、进阶技巧:专业场景优化方案
1. 网络环境调优
• 启用QoS流量控制(路由器设置→带宽管理),优先保障下载进程。
• 公共WiFi环境下使用ExpressVPN加密传输,防止MITM中间人攻击。2. 自动化脚本与云测集成
• 编写Python脚本调用aria2 API实现定时下载任务,结合GitHub Actions自动同步镜像仓库更新。
• 支付宝小程序开发者工具内置真机云测服务,可在上传前完成兼容性验证与性能瓶颈定位。五、特殊场景解决方案
1. 单片机程序烧录
使用CH340芯片实现USB转串口通信,安装官方驱动后通过Keil uVision完成固件编译与烧录,注意设置波特率(常用115200bps)与校验位。
2. 网盘资源加速
百度网盘非会员用户可通过油猴脚本提取直链,配合IDM多线程突破限速。阿里云盘利用rclone挂载为本地磁盘,实现CLI批量下载。
高效安全的程序下载需综合运用系统工具、第三方平台与专业技术。建议用户建立“官方优先→工具辅助→安全验证→环境优化”的四层防护体系,针对开发调试、嵌入式系统等特殊场景选择定制化方案。定期更新本文所述工具(如CH340驱动v2.6、IDM 6.42)可确保兼容最新系统特性。